UPDATE READ THIS!! The newest version of pygame_gui is clashing with the pygame module as it wants to use DIRECTION_LTR from pygame-ce (pygame's community edition) but since pygame doesnt have this it will error out HOWEVER when you install pygame-ce it will also error out this time becouse pygame-ce doesn't have the surface submodule now i don't know what is going on but editing pygame_gui/core/interfaces/colour_gradient_interface.py line 18 from pygame.surface.Surface to pygame.Surface seemed to work but i cannot guarantee it will work. I don't know what is going on with pygame and pygame_gui but i don't care enough so if you REALLY want to run this you will have to figure something out i'm done. you can use an older version of pygame and pygame_gui aswell.
